Concrete Settlement Repair in Miami Dade County, FL
Concrete settlement repair services address issues where existing concrete surfaces, such as driveways, walkways, patios, or garage floors, have shifted, sunk, or cracked due to ground movement or soil instability. These repairs typically involve lifting and leveling uneven concrete, filling cracks, or stabilizing the foundation to restore a smooth, safe, and durable surface. Property owners often seek this service to improve curb appeal, prevent further deterioration, and ensure safety around their homes or commercial properties.
Before requesting concrete settlement repair,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the damage, the underlying causes of settling, and the best methods for repair. It’s important to consider the age of the concrete, the severity of unevenness or cracking, and whether ongoing ground movement might affect the longevity of the repair. Clear communication about these factors can help determine the most effective solution to maintain the stability and appearance of the concrete surfaces.

Common Concrete Settlement Repair Jobs
Foundation Settlement Repair - stabilizes uneven concrete slabs caused by shifting soil.
Driveway and Patio Repair - restores levelness and prevents further cracking in outdoor surfaces.
Garage Floor Repair - addresses uneven or cracked concrete to improve safety and appearance.
Slab Jacking - lifts and stabilizes sunken concrete using foam or mud jacking techniques.
Concrete Leveling - corrects uneven surfaces for safer walkways and driveways.
Structural Repair - reinforces concrete foundations to prevent future settlement issues.
Concrete Settlement Repair Questions
What causes concrete to settle? Concrete settlement often occurs due to soil movement, poor compaction, or changes in moisture levels beneath the slab.
How can I tell if my concrete has settled? Signs include uneven surfaces, cracks, or gaps between the slab and adjacent structures.
What types of projects require settlement repair? Common projects include driveways, patios, sidewalks, and garage floors that show signs of sinking or cracking.
Is settlement repair necessary for safety? Yes, addressing settlement issues can help prevent further damage and maintain the stability of the structure.
